Cranberry Sweet-and-Sour Pork

Prep Time: 20 Minutes
Cook Time: 0 Minutes
Ready In: 20 Minutes
Servings: 6
This fresh take on a beloved Asian-style dish is sure to cause a stir at the dinner table.
Ingredients:
1 tablespoon cornstarch
1/2 cup unsweetened pineapple juice
1 cup whole-berry cranberry sauce
1/2 cup barbecue sauce
1-1/2 pounds pork tenderloin, cut into 1/2-inch cubes
1 tablespoon canola oil
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1 medium green pepper, cut into strips
3/4 cup pineapple tidbits
hot cooked rice or chow mein noodles
Directions:
1. In a small bowl, combine cornstarch and pineapple juice until smooth. Stir in cranberry and barbecue sauces; set aside.
2. In a large skillet, stir-fry pork in oil for 3 minutes or until meat is no longer pink. Sprinkle with salt and pepper. Remove from the pan and keep warm.
3. Add green pepper and pineapple to pan; stir-fry for 2 minutes. Stir cornstarch mixture and add to skillet. Bring to a boil. C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Add pork; heat through. Serve with rice or noodles. Yield: 6 servings.
